§51.1150. U.S. No. 3.

7 C.F.R. § 51.1150

“U.S. No. 3” consists of oranges which meet the following requirements:
(a)
Basic requirements—
(1)
Mature;
(2)
Misshapen;
(3)
Poorly colored;
(4)
Rough texture, not seriously lumpy;
(5)
Similar varietal characteristics; and
(6)
Slightly spongy.
(b)
Free from—
(1)
Decay;
(2)
Unhealed skin breaks; and
(3)
Wormy fruit.
(c)
Free from very serious damage caused by—
(1)
Ammoniation;
(2)
Bruises;
(3)
Buckskin;
(4)
Caked melanose;
(5)
Creasing;
(6)
Disease;
(7)
Dryness or mushy condition;
(8)
Hail;
(9)
Insects;
(10)
Riciness or woodiness;
(11)
Scab;
(12)
Scale;
(13)
Scars;
(14)
Skin breakdown;
(15)
Split navels;
(16)
Sprayburn;
(17)
Sunburn; and
(18)
Other means.
(d)
For tolerances see § 51.1151.
(e)
Internal quality— Lots meeting the internal requirements for “U.S. Grade AA Juice (Double A)” or “U.S. Grade A Juice” may be so specified in connection with the grade. (See §§ 51.1176-51.1179.)
